Shut-In Ministry We provide visitation and support for individuals in residences and retirement facilities who are unable to join us for our many activities. We also have a Mobile Ministry Team that provides a worship service twice a month in two different retirement communities.

Preschool The Cross Lanes United Methodist Preschool has been serving the Cross Lanes and surrounding communities since the early 1970’s. The teachers have degrees and the staff all have had background checks. The mission of the CLUM Preschool is to further your child’s social, emotional, physical, and intellectual development through guided play and creative activities. We offer classes for 4, 3 and 2 year-old children. For further information please call the church office at 304-776-3081. United Methodist Women Prayer Shawls Several dedicated women in our church meet to knit and crochet prayer shawls. The shawls are dedicated and given to those who need comfort in times of hurt and suffering. If you know someone who could benefit from receiving a prayer shawl please call the church office.
